Eid-el-Kabir: Ilorin emir seeks peace, police promise security

Date: 2019-08-10

The Emir of Ilorin, Alhaji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ari, has enjoined Nigerian pilgrims to pray for the unity, peace and prosperity of the country.

He also urged Nigerians to intensify prayers for Muslims, who were performing pilgrimage in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.

In a message on Thursday by the National Secretary of Shehu Alimi Foundation for Peace and Development, Mallam Abdulazeez Arowona, the monarch wished them safe return.

He said, "Hajj is a strong pillar in the Islamic jurisprudence as enjoined by Allah. I heartily felicitate with Muslim Ummah across the world especially contingents from Kwara State who have answered the call of Allah by offering themselves to perform this year's Hajj exercise.

"I urged wealthy Muslims to extend hands of charity to the underprivileged during the festive period to promote love and harmony.
